Keratin-associated protein 5-9 (KRTAP5-9)

Overview

Keratin-associated protein 5-9 is a matrix protein found in the cortex of hair fibers, where it embeds the keratin intermediate filaments and helps confer strength and rigidity to the hair shaft. It achieves this through extensive disulfide bond cross-linking due to abundant cysteine residues. KRTAP5-9 is classified among the high-sulfur keratin-associated proteins, a family essential for hair formation and mechanical properties. It is not associated with therapeutic targeting, disease diagnostics, or drug interactions[3][5][11].
